Better Placed are pleased to be working with a well-regarded premium food business who are looking for a Business Development Manager and an Account Manager to join their sales team, managing relationships with new and existing customers across the EMEA region. You will be working within the B2B side of the business, selling ingredients into food manufacturers.

Main responsibilities:

  • Developing and implementing a commercial Joint Business Plans (JBP's) with the customer
  • Business Development to bring on new customers (BDM Role)
  • Growing and developing existing customers (AM Role)
  • Delivering profitable and sustainable sales growth
  • Controlling budgets and forecasting
  • Building strong relationships with customer and key stakeholders
  • Maintaining daily contact with customer and attending regular face-to-face meetings
  • Keeping up with key category trends and identifying new business opportunities

What we need from you:

  • Minimum 3 years in account management or business development
  • Experience selling ingredients B2B is a must
  • Ideally experience working across the EMEA region
  • Experience managing a P&L
  • Highly-motivated to drive your career and development further quickly
  • Commercially astute with strong negotiation and presentation skills
  • Background in stimulating account growth and gaining new business
